## Onboarding: Farebranch Rules Engine

Plugin authors integrate with Farebranch by registering fee rules against the evaluation API. Rules are sandboxed; they cannot perform network calls directly. All rate-table lookups go through the host, which validates your plugin manifest at load time. Your local env file must include the signing credential the host uses to verify manifests, set on the next line.

secret setting of bajef-fajof: COURIER_KEY3=76c

The Farevale rules engine computes shipping fees from YAML rule packs loaded at boot. Release managers should know that rule packs are validated in staging before promotion, and a failed validation blocks the deploy train automatically. No manual overrides exist by design. When cutting a release, regenerate the service env file from the template, confirm the region and tier settings match the target cluster, then add the rules-store access secret directly below this line.

vault entry, kafog-yahop: COURIER_KEY8=0faa53ae

## Formula sandbox tuning

User-supplied formulas in Gridmoor execute inside a restricted interpreter with hard ceilings on time, memory, and call depth. Reviewers should confirm any change to these ceilings is justified in the PR description, since raising them widens the abuse surface. Defaults were chosen from production traces. The current limits are as follows.

limits module of tafog-fawip:
WEIGHTS = {
    "julix": 57,
    "lamys": 992,
    "kasvan": 209,
    "quenok": 750,
    "alddor": 259,
    "oliath": 1009,
    "wenix": 815,
}

Hey Tomas — handing off the bloom filter that fronts the Kestrelbox KV store. It's tuned for ~1% false positives at current key volume; resize it if inserts pass 80M or lookups get slow. Rebuild script runs nightly, don't touch it on Fridays. All the gory details are written up here.

wiki page, tahaf-tajog: https://jira.ordindyn.corp/pipeline

- [ ] **Step 7: Breaker override escrow.** After sealing the signing keys for the Tallgrove upstream API circuit breaker, confirm the support team can force the breaker open during a full outage. The override bundle lives in the sealed escrow drawer and is useless without its unlock phrase. Two ceremony witnesses must initial this step before proceeding. The escrow bundle is decrypted with the recovery passphrase that follows.

vault phrase of kahip-kahop = holath-quenmir